Transaction 52de9f993b7c059a28bec040c648d6ad74c58386bfa65dec7efd0c7d0e84b395
1 Input
1 Output
-
52de9f993b7c059a28bec040c648d6ad74c58386bfa65dec7efd0c7d0e84b395:0
- value
- 623664
- script pubkey
- OP_0 OP_PUSHBYTES_32 18973f894b60eefcba031df79145b10baa8149ed2c737b5703d3d693da967d67
- address
- bc1qrztnlz2tvrh0ewsrrhmez3d3pw4gzj0d93ehk4cr60tf8k5k04nstyefuu